Our Christmas friends had recommended that rather than drive around the coast to Melbourne we should take the Queenscliffe to Sorrento ferry which would save us a 200km drive.
How lucky we did because on the last fifteen minutes of the crossing a pod of about 10 dolphins swam along side the ship, jumping, rolling over and swimming on their backs throughly entertaining all the people stood on deck, it was magical to watch, we managed to get some photos on the camera.
Sorrento was a lovely seaside town very pretty, but we decided to move along the coast to find a campsite for the night. The photograph on this blog shows one of the beaches on this lovely stretch of coastline.
